Legal Assistance: Bridging the Gap to Equitable Justice in Pakistan

In Pakistan, access to justice is a significant challenge for many citizens. Legal costs can be prohibitively high, leaving marginalized populations without the means to obtain legal advocacy. This disparity results in a two-tier system where only those with financial resources can fully address the complex legal landscape.

Free legal aid programs play a vital role in narrowing this gap by providing free of charge legal assistance to those who lack the capacity to afford it. These programs provide a range of services, including guidance, legal advocacy, and assistance with legal documents.

Via free legal aid, individuals can protect their rights, seek redress for complaints, and participate in the legal process on an equal footing.

These programs are not only essential for ensuring access to justice but also for reinforcing the rule of law and promoting community fairness.

Enhancing access to free legal aid is a crucial step towards creating a more just and equitable society in Pakistan.

Unlocking Access : Making Justice Easier and More Accessible in Pakistan

Justice plays a vital role in building a just society. In Pakistan, though, access to justice remains a major challenge.

Several elements contribute to this difficulty. Lack of resources can prevent individuals from accessing legal representation. Complex legal systems can be overwhelming to navigate. Furthermore, a shortage of awareness about one's entitlements worsens the issue.

To resolve this persistent challenge, it is essential to implement measures that increase access to justice for all Pakistanis. This comprises advocating for legal assistance, modernizing legal procedures, and increasing legal literacy.
